How do you replace a broken brake light?

Use your head lamp or flashlight to determine which bulb in the housing is the brake light. Turn the brake light holder counterclockwise to release it, then pull the bulb holder and bulb into the trunk. Remove the bulb from the holder.

How much does it cost to replace brake light?

On Amazon.com, for example, the average brake light bulb can cost anywhere from $8 to $17 , while at AutoZone.com, you can find some bulbs for as little as $5. To do it yourself, the costs can almost always be less than $20. According to 2CarPros.com, the average bulb at your local repair shop can cost anywhere from $35 to $55 .
